The $11 Mistake That Changed How I Buy Radios

I found ten Midland handhelds priced $11 less per unit than our regular supplier. Eleven dollars. On ten radios that's $110, which felt like a small win during a budget review. So I skipped my usual step of checking which radio service they operated on. I figured: box says Midland, it's a radio, we use radios. What are the odds it wouldn't talk to our trucks?

Pretty good odds, it turned out. Our trucks ran CB. The handhelds were FRS. A CB radio can't hear an FRS signal, and an FRS radio can't hear a CB. The crew showed up at a job site with the new handhelds and couldn't reach the trucks at all.

The vendor's invoice made it worse. It listed everything as “miscellaneous radio equipment,” with no line-item detail, so finance rejected the expense report and I ate $340 out of the department budget. Add return shipping, a restocking fee, and an overnight order for the right units, and that $110 “savings” cost us somewhere around $900. That's when total cost of ownership stopped being a phrase I used in meetings and became the way I actually buy.

What I Buy Now: Midland Automotive Gear, Thought Through

Since 2023, every vehicle in our fleet that needs convoy comms gets the same setup: a 40-channel CB radio, or, where a fixed unit isn't practical, a Midland 75-822 portable CB with an external antenna added. I write “CB ONLY, NOT FRS, NOT GMRS” on the PO so the next person doesn't repeat my mistake.

The Midland automotive catalog is broad enough that you can buy a perfectly good radio that is still the wrong radio. It includes CB handhelds, FRS and GMRS handhelds, mobile radios, antennas, headsets, and plenty of accessories. They're decent products. They are not interchangeable. So before you ask “which model,” ask “which service do the radios I already own use?” That's the whole trick.

There's a second question that costs people money: does the price include everything needed to install it? A bare radio is not a working radio. You need an antenna, a mount, coax, and sometimes a noise filter. The cheapest incomplete quote is not the cheapest quote.

Midland CB for Motorcycle Use: What We Learned

The request came from one of our field techs, who rides a motorcycle to check utility right-of-way. He needed to coordinate with two trucks usually about a mile down the road. The trucks were already on CB, so he asked whether we could set up a Midland CB for motorcycle use on his bike. Short answer: yes, with three things: a CB that accepts an external antenna, a headset adapter, and an antenna mounted somewhere high and clear of the rider's body.

We used a 75-822, added the headset, and mounted an external antenna on top of the rear luggage rack. Realistically, we see one to three miles in open country and less in hills. That's the nature of CB at legal power, not a radio problem. For keeping a crew coordinated on a job site or moving between sites on two-lane roads, it's been reliable enough.

The 2024 Ford Raptor Cold Air Intake That Didn't Make It

Our operations director drives a 2024 Ford Raptor, which sounds extravagant until you see the roads to our job sites. In early 2025 he pitched a cold air intake: more horsepower, better throttle response, the usual claims. I told him I'd approve it as a test with one rule: if it made a measurable difference on the routes we actually drive, we'd keep it. If not, it went back before the return window closed.

The install was straightforward. The first sign of trouble wasn't a lack of power. It was a whistle, mostly between 2,500 and 3,000 rpm. Mild, but persistent, and it made a nearly new truck sound like it had a vacuum leak. We checked for leaks, reinstalled the intake twice, and were about to start testing sensors when I found a long exblog air filter whistle post by another Raptor owner who had chased the same sound. His conclusion, after weeks of testing: the whistle was just air moving through the high-flow filter. Not a leak. Not a defect. Just noise.

That matched our experience. After six weeks, nobody could say the truck felt faster. Fuel economy hadn't moved. The only measurable difference was the whistle. We returned the intake, paid a 15% restocking fee, and put the factory unit back on. On a modern turbo engine with an intercooler and a factory intake duct, the cold air intake usually isn't the bottleneck. The sound is the product.

I don't blame the aftermarket for existing. I blame the assumption that an intake is free horsepower. That idea is older than the powertrain it gets bolted to.

Can a Radar Detector Detect Lidar? Only After You've Been Measured

The radar detector question usually comes from drivers, not from me. Last year a supervisor pointed at a speeding ticket and said that if we had detectors, it wouldn't have happened. I didn't argue with him in the moment. I went and researched it, because the last time I bought based on “it'll probably work,” I lost $340.

Here's the plain-language version. A radar detector is a radio receiver. It listens for the radio waves that police radar guns transmit. Lidar does not work that way. A lidar gun fires a narrow beam of infrared light pulses and times how long the reflection takes to come back. You cannot catch light with a radio antenna.

Most radar detectors do have a laser sensor, and on a good day it will pick up scattered light if the officer is measuring a car ahead. That's the best-case scenario. If the beam is aimed at your vehicle, the measurement has already happened by the time the detector beeps. So the honest answer to “can a radar detector detect lidar?” is: it might light up, but it will not save you from the ticket.

For a fleet buyer, the decision wrote itself. A detector costs money per vehicle, and what it buys is a false sense of security. If a driver needs a radar detector to stay ticket-free, the problem is the driving, not the equipment. Spending the same money on GPS speed alerts and driver accountability is a better trade.

Where I'd Push Back On My Own Advice

Three caveats so this doesn't read as universal truth:

  • If you only need one radio for one truck, none of this fleet logic applies. Buy a Midland handheld that matches the service everyone else uses and move on. TCO math matters when a wrong decision gets multiplied across 14 vehicles.
  • If you're building a personal off-road truck for fun, a cold air intake is fine. Just be honest that you're buying sound and maybe a few horsepower. That's a legitimate purchase. It's just not a work-truck purchase.
  • The radio, licensing, and detector rules I've mentioned are U.S.-specific and they change. Verify current requirements before you buy. I'm a purchasing manager, not a lawyer or a compliance consultant.
